Been working on Finn's 183 build. Made a some progress over the past week.
On the cockpit I used a dark gray paint for the overall surface. Cut off the cast gun sight and replaced it with a clear piece of acrylic.
Image
Image
Image
Image
Image
Image
Image
Image
Image

On the Jumo I used steel for the darker color, aluminum for the lighter areas and flat black. I drilled 1/4" larger holes and 5/32 smaller holes to simulate looking thru the sheet metal into the inside portion of the engine.
Image
Image
Image
Image

X4's
Started off with some flat black, Aluminum and Steel.
Image
Image
Image
The tip is painted with a 50/50 mix of plaid and white.

The wire pod I call it is painted with black, steel and red.
Image

For the fins I used Silver, black, Brown, Yellow, Burnt Umber and Van Dyke Brown. Not shown is the Plaid and white acrylic.
Image

I cut a template for the center panel to create the border. Randomly mixing the colors to create variations in the wood color.
Image
Image
Image
